About Kimball Electronics Group

Kimball Electronics Group is a global electronics manufacturing services (EMS) company that specializes in producing durable electronics for the automotive, medical, industrial, and public safety markets. The company was founded in 1961 and is headquartered in Jasper, Indiana. Kimball Electronics Group has manufacturing facilities in the United States, Mexico, China, Thailand, and Poland. The company's services include design, engineering, manufacturing, and supply chain management. Kimball Electronics Group is committed to sustainability and has implemented a number of initiatives to reduce its environmental impact, including reducing waste and energy consumption.
